Section 10 — Prohibition of certain names
Statute text
(1) No company shall be
registered by a name which contains such word or expression, as may be notified
by the Commission or in the opinion of the registrar is—
(a) identical with or resemble or similar to the name of a company; or
(b) inappropriate; or
(c) undesirable; or
(d) deceptive; or
(e) designed to exploit or offend religious susceptibilities of the people;
or
(f) any other ground as may be specified.
(2) Except with prior approval in writing of the Commission, no
company shall be registered by a name which contains any word suggesting or
calculated to suggest—
(a) the patronage of any past or present Pakistani or foreign head of
state;
(b) any connection with the Federal Government or a Provincial
Government or any department or authority or statutory body of any
such Government;
(c) any connection with any corporation set up by or under any Federal
or Provincial law;
(d) the patronage of, or any connection with, any foreign Government
or any international organisation;
(e) establishing a modaraba management company or to float a
modaraba; or
(f) any other business requiring licence from the Commission.
(3) Whenever a question arises as to whether or not the name of a
company is in violation of the foregoing provisions of this section, decision of the
Commission shall be final.
(4) A person may make an application, in such form and manner and
accompanied by such fee as may be specified, to the registrar for reservation of a
name set out in the application for a period not exceeding sixty days.
(5) Where it is found that a name was reserved under sub-section (4),
by furnishing false or incorrect information, such reservation shall be cancelled and
in case the company has been incorporated, it shall be directed to change its name.
The person making application under sub-section (4) shall be liable to a penalty not
exceeding level 1 on the standard scale.
(6) If the name a pplied for under sub -section (4) is refused by the
registrar, the aggrieved person may within thirty days of the order of refusal prefer
an appeal to the Commission.
(7) An order of the Commission under sub-section (6) shall be final and
shall not be called in question before any court or other authority.

App-1 — Application for Reservation of Name for New Incorporation or Change of Name
Application for Reservation of Name for New Incorporation or Change of Name
Regulation: Regulations 3 & 4
Fee reference: please refer to the Seventh Schedule.
Filed electronically through the eZfile portal at leap.secp.gov.pk, after logging in with the credentials of the company's authorised form signatory. The exact fee is calculated automatically by the portal once the form is submitted, based on the actual event dates and details you enter — figures shown here are Seventh Schedule reference amounts, not a guaranteed final charge.
